Sourcing guidance for Ecu Tuning Tools

What are the key technical specifications to consider when selecting ECU tuning tools for professional use?

When sourcing ECU tuning tools, prioritize Master vs. Slave versions depending on your technical capacity; Master tools allow for independent file editing, while Slave tools are linked to a specific tuner. Ensure the hardware supports multiple protocols such as OBDII, Bench, and Boot mode to cover a wide range of vehicle models. Look for high-speed USB 3.0 or Bluetooth 5.0 connectivity to ensure stable data transmission during the flashing process, as any interruption can lead to ECU 'bricking'. Additionally, verify that the tool includes checksum correction capabilities to ensure the modified software is valid before writing.

How do I ensure the ECU tuning tool is compatible with specific vehicle brands and regions?

Compatibility is determined by the vehicle coverage list provided by the manufacturer. You must verify support for specific ECU types (e.g., Bosch, Delphi, Continental, Denso) and communication protocols like CAN-bus, K-Line, and J2534. For cross-border buyers, it is crucial to confirm if the software is region-locked or if it supports global vehicle databases. Always request a current compatibility list from the supplier on Made-in-China.com to ensure the hardware supports the latest 2023-2024 vehicle models.

What compliance and safety standards should these electronic tools meet?

Professional ECU tools must adhere to CE, FCC, and RoHS certifications to ensure electronic safety and environmental compliance. Since these tools interface with a vehicle's critical systems, look for suppliers who offer built-in voltage protection and recovery modes that can restore an ECU if a write failure occurs. Furthermore, ensure the software provided is genuine and licensed, as pirated 'clone' tools often lack technical support and carry a high risk of damaging expensive vehicle hardware.

What kind of after-sales and technical support is necessary for high-end tuning equipment?

Due to the complexity of ECU remapping, prioritize suppliers offering lifetime software updates and remote technical assistance (via TeamViewer or Anydesk). A reliable supplier should provide a minimum 1-year hardware warranty and access to a technical knowledge base or forum. Check if the supplier offers subscription-based or one-time payment models for protocol updates, as this significantly impacts the long-term cost of ownership.

Cross-Border Procurement Risks and Strategies for ECU Tuning Tools

How can I mitigate the risk of purchasing 'clone' or counterfeit tuning hardware?

The market is flooded with low-cost clones that can be unstable. To mitigate this, verify the supplier's authorization status and check for unique serial numbers that can be registered on the official manufacturer's website. What are the best practices for negotiating with ECU tool suppliers?

Focus your negotiation not just on the unit price, but on bundled software protocols. Often, the hardware is relatively inexpensive, but the 'full version' software licenses are costly. Negotiate for free protocol activations for the first year or discounted tokens for online services. For bulk orders, request customized branding (OEM) on the hardware casing and software splash screen to build your own brand identity.

What should I consider regarding international shipping and customs for sensitive electronics?

ECU tools are sensitive electronic devices. Ensure the supplier uses anti-static packaging and shock-resistant padding. For customs, ensure the HS Code (typically 903180) is correctly declared to avoid delays. Be aware that some countries have strict regulations on diagnostic software imports; always ask the supplier to provide a clean invoice and all necessary export licenses to facilitate smooth customs clearance.
